## Changelog — Font vendoring defaults changed

As of this release, the Bracken UI build no longer fetches third-party fonts at build time. All typefaces used by the Lanternwell suite are now vendored into the repo under a dedicated assets directory, and the fetch step is skipped by default. If you're onboarding, nothing to install — the fonts travel with the checkout. The build flags controlling this behavior are listed below.

settings of hadup-yafog:
LAMAEL_PIN=3761
LAMAEL_TENANT=istmir
LAMAEL_METRICS_HOST=metrics.lamael.plorvasys.test
LAMAEL_SEAL=seal_8ea68500
LAMAEL_STANDBY_TEAM=fraok

Action item (owner: catalogue team): the Lanternfell library catalogue import failed partway through and retried without deduplication, creating duplicate record identifiers. We will add an idempotency check keyed on source row hash, enforce a hard cap on batch size, and log every rejected row for audit. For the security review, note that retry and throttling behaviour is governed entirely by the constants below.

tuning table, yajog-yahof:
BUDGETS = {
    "lamvan": 303,
    "wenox": 460,
    "fenvan": 525,
}

Team,

Cut-over of the Quickfern serverless handlers finished overnight. All traffic now hits the pre-warmed pool; cold starts dropped from ~4s to under 400ms. Old on-demand handlers are disabled, not deleted — leave them alone for a week. Warmer pings run every five minutes; don't silence those in monitoring, they're intentional. If latency spikes, check pool saturation first. The warm pool runs with the configuration values below.

deployment values, kahof-yadug:
[gorys]
team = silael
access_code = ac_00d620
owner = istox.oliys
host = gorys.torvastack.example
port = 9000
peer = holmir.merlaqsoft.example
salt = 9fdae78a
pin = 2358